Understanding the JE overview in 2026

Which Exams Are We Talking About?

The term "AE/JE" (Assistant Engineer / Junior Engineer) covers a broad ecosystem of government engineering recruitment exams. For Mechanical Engineering students, the most prominent ones in 2026 include:

  • SSC JE 2026 — Conducted by the Staff Selection Commission; recruits for CPWD, MES, BRO and other central government departments. Paper 1 carries 200 marks and Paper 2 carries 300 marks.
  • RRB JE 2026 — Conducted by Railway Recruitment Boards; 2,585 vacancies announced with CBT exams scheduled in February–March 2026. CBT 1 tests general aptitude; CBT 2 tests technical knowledge.
  • State AE/JE Exams — Conducted by state PSCs such as UKPSC JE, HPPSC JE, RPSC AEN, DSSSB JE, JKSSB JE, UPPSC AE, and many more — all following a core mechanical syllabus.
  • PSU JE Exams — Conducted by public sector undertakings like BEL, BHEL, SAIL, HPCL, NTPC, ONGC, and others — requiring B.Tech-level technical depth.
Key Insight: All of these exams share a remarkably similar technical syllabus at the core — Thermodynamics, Strength of Materials, Theory of Machines, Fluid Mechanics, and Production Engineering form the backbone of every Mechanical JE-level exam in India. This overlap is precisely what makes a single comprehensive course so effective.

What Does the Mechanical AE/JE Syllabus 2026 Actually Cover?

The Mechanical Engineering syllabus for AE/JE exams — as prescribed by SSC, RRB, and most state boards — can be grouped into the following major areas:

Core Technical Subjects

  • Thermodynamics — Laws of thermodynamics, steam tables, IC engines, gas turbines, Carnot and Rankine cycles, steam nozzles, refrigeration principles.
  • Strength of Materials (SOM) — Stress and strain, bending moments, shear force diagrams, torsion, columns and struts, springs.
  • Theory of Machines (TOM) — Kinematics of links, four-bar mechanisms, cams, gears, flywheel, governor, balancing of rotating masses.
  • Fluid Mechanics & Hydraulics — Properties of fluids, Bernoulli's theorem, flow through pipes, hydraulic turbines and pumps, open channel flow.
  • Production Engineering — Casting, welding, forging, metal cutting, lathe, milling, drilling, grinding, NDT, manufacturing tolerances.
  • Engineering Mechanics — Laws of motion, friction, virtual work, kinematics and dynamics of particles.
  • Machine Design — Design of shafts, keys, couplings, bearings, springs, and bolted joints.
  • Industrial Engineering & OR — Work study, inventory control, CPM and PERT, production planning, queuing theory.
  • Refrigeration & Air Conditioning (RAC) — Vapour compression cycles, psychrometrics, air conditioning systems.

Non-Technical Subjects

  • General Intelligence & Reasoning — Analogies, series completion, coding-decoding, spatial reasoning, logical deduction.
  • General Awareness — Current affairs, Indian history, geography, polity, economics, science and technology.
  • Quantitative Aptitude — Arithmetic, percentage, profit & loss, time-speed-distance, basic algebra and geometry.
